Identity
Born in 1642 at Woolsthorpe Manor in Lincolnshire, a premature and posthumous child; his mother remarried when he was three and left him in the care of his grandmother, and he later entered Trinity College, Cambridge, in 1661 as a subsizar — a student who paid his way by performing duties for wealthier students. (Wikipedia, 2026)
The founding conditions are abandonment and subordinate status, and the response was not sociability but withdrawal into work. The configuration that later produced a unified physics was first a survival strategy: the one place nobody could intrude was the problem.

Trajectory
When Cambridge closed during the plague of 1665–1666 he returned to Woolsthorpe, where over roughly two years he developed his early work on calculus, the composition of light and the theory of gravitation; he was appointed Lucasian Professor of Mathematics in 1669, published the Principia in 1687, moved to the Royal Mint in 1696, and served as President of the Royal Society from 1703 until his death in 1727.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The trajectory has an unusual shape: almost the entire intellectual output is front-loaded into a burst in his twenties, the great synthesis is published at forty-four, and the second half of life is administration and institutional power. The science was a phase; the control of the institutions that judged science was the career.

Business Model
His income came from a Trinity College fellowship and the Lucasian chair, then from crown office: as Warden and later Master of the Royal Mint he oversaw the Great Recoinage and personally pursued counterfeiters, a capital offence, securing convictions through his own investigations.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The economic engine is institutional position rather than enterprise — a fellowship, a chair, a sinecure that he refused to treat as one. The Mint years reveal the same temperament as the physics: when handed a currency to protect, he prosecuted the problem to its edges with a thoroughness that made the job considerably larger than it had been.

Impact
The Principia formulated the three laws of motion and the law of universal gravitation, showing that a single inverse-square force explained both terrestrial falling bodies and the orbits of the planets and the moon; Opticks reported his experimental demonstration that white light is composed of a spectrum of colours and described the reflecting telescope he built.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The impact is unification: before the Principia, the sky and the ground were separate subjects governed by separate rules, and after it they were one system described by one mathematics. Cognition
He developed the method of fluxions — his form of calculus — as a tool for the physical problems he was working on, and in the Principia presented his results in the geometric language of classical proofs; his optical work proceeded by experiment, including passing light through prisms to decompose and recompose it.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The characteristic move is building the instrument before using it: when the available mathematics could not express continuous change, he invented one that could, then solved the problem. Tool-making and problem-solving are a single loop, which is why the output looks less like discovery and more like construction.

Behavior
He worked for extended periods in near-total seclusion, delayed publication of major results for years or decades, reacted to criticism of his optical papers by withdrawing from correspondence, and conducted a prolonged priority dispute with Leibniz over the invention of calculus in which the Royal Society, under his presidency, issued a report in his favour that he had substantially written himself.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
Two behaviours look contradictory and are not: he avoided publishing, and he fought ferociously over credit. Both are the same drive — total ownership of the work. Publishing exposed it to others; priority disputes reclaimed it. The reclusiveness and the ruthlessness are one trait seen from two sides.

Decision Architecture
He published the Principia only after Edmond Halley visited him in 1684, asked about planetary orbits, and personally underwrote the printing; he accepted the Mint post in 1696 and thereafter produced little new scientific work, while devoting substantial private effort to alchemy and biblical chronology that he never published.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The architecture defaults to not shipping. Every major release required an external forcing function — Halley for the Principia, a crown appointment for the move to London. Left to himself the system optimizes for continuing to work on a problem, not for concluding it; the world got the physics because someone else made the decision.

Personality
He never married, had few close friendships, was described by contemporaries as suspicious and quick to take offence, and suffered what is usually described as a breakdown around 1693 marked by accusations against friends and a period of withdrawal. (Wikipedia, 2026)
The temperament is that of a system with no slack for other people. Everything was allocated to the work and to the defense of the work, and the interpersonal record — the feuds, the suspicion, the collapse — is what that allocation looks like from the outside.

Power & Influence
As President of the Royal Society for twenty-four years and Master of the Mint he held the two positions with the most direct authority over English science and English money; he was knighted in 1705 and was buried in Westminster Abbey.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
Unlike da Vinci, whose influence was borrowed and posthumous, Newton converted intellectual standing into institutional control within his lifetime and used it — on the calculus dispute, on appointments, on the direction of the Society. The second career was the accumulation of power the first career had earned.

Value System
He declined to propose a mechanism for gravity, writing that he framed no hypotheses and that it was enough that gravity existed and acted according to the laws he had set out; he was privately a heterodox Christian who rejected the doctrine of the Trinity and wrote extensively on theology and alchemy without publishing.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The public value is mathematical sufficiency — describe what can be measured and refuse to speculate beyond it. The private value was the opposite: decades of unpublished speculation on scripture and transmutation. He enforced on the world a discipline he did not impose on himself, and kept the two rigorously separate.

Friction & Constraints
His early optical paper of 1672 drew criticism from Robert Hooke and others that he found intolerable, contributing to a long withdrawal from publication; the later dispute with Leibniz soured relations between English and continental mathematics, and English mathematicians continued to use Newton's less convenient notation for generations.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The binding constraint is the same as the core strength: an inability to tolerate shared ownership. It cost him decades of publication, and the priority war he won cost his country a century of mathematical progress by isolating it from Leibniz's superior notation. The system defended the author at the expense of the work.

Legacy Vector
The laws of motion and universal gravitation remained the governing framework of physics until relativity and quantum mechanics in the twentieth century and remain the working model for most engineering today; calculus, developed independently by Newton and Leibniz, became the mathematical foundation of modern science. (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026; Wikipedia, 2026)
The legacy is infrastructure. Nobody thinks about Newtonian mechanics when designing a bridge any more than they think about TCP/IP when sending an email — it is simply the layer everything else runs on. That is the most durable form a legacy can take: invisible because it is assumed.
